Effects of Ocean Acidification:
Effects of ocean acidification arise as increased carbon dioxide in the atmosphere dissolves in ocean waters. Acidification can harm shellfish and other marine species reliant on calcium carbonate, integral for their shells and skeletons. The Canadian Fisheries Research Network (2019) states that acidification has begun to affect local fisheries, particularly those harvesting shellfish like clams and oysters, leading to concerns about sustainability. -

Licensing Regulations:
Licensing regulations ensure that only qualified individuals and organizations can participate in fishing activities. Fishermen must obtain a fishing license, which helps regulate the number of active fishers and control fishing practices. The licenses may require compliance with specific guidelines, such as gear type and sizes. This system helps manage fish stocks and ensures that fishing occurs within sustainable limits. -
Fishing Quotas:
Fishing quotas limit the amount of fish that can be caught in a given period, typically set based on scientific assessments of fish populations. These quotas are adjusted annually to reflect stock health. For example, the Total Allowable Catch (TAC) is commonly used to ensure that fishing does not exceed sustainable levels. This method helps prevent overfishing and ensures long-term viability for both the species and the industry. -
Enforcement and Monitoring:
Enforcement of fishing regulations is crucial to ensure compliance and protect fish stocks. Fisheries officers conduct monitoring activities, including at-sea and dockside inspections. These officers enforce laws related to catch limits and prohibited species. Advanced surveillance technology, like satellite tracking, supports monitoring efforts. Strong enforcement helps maintain sustainable fishing practices and protects valuable marine resources. -
Indigenous Rights and Collaborations:
Indigenous rights play a significant role in Canada’s fishing regulations. Various treaties recognize Indigenous communities’ rights to fish and manage their resources sustainably. Collaborations between Indigenous groups and government bodies often lead to co-management initiatives that respect traditional knowledge and practices. For instance, the Mi’kmaq and the Government of Nova Scotia have developed collaborative approaches to manage lobster fishing effectively. -

How Do Government Policies Shape the Future of Canada’s Fishing Industry?
Government policies significantly shape the future of Canada’s fishing industry by influencing conservation practices, regulating fish stocks, and supporting economic sustainability.
Conservation practices: The Canadian government implements policies aimed at preserving marine ecosystems. These policies are crucial for maintaining biodiversity and ensuring sustainable fish populations. For instance, the Fisheries Act mandates the protection of fish habitats, which directly impacts the long-term viability of various fish species.
Regulating fish stocks: Effective management of fish stocks helps balance ecological health with economic interests. Policies like Total Allowable Catches (TACs) limit the number of fish that can be harvested. Research by the Department of Fisheries and Oceans (DFO) indicates that proper stock assessments can lead to recovery in overfished species, such as cod (DFO, 2020). This regulation is vital for preventing overfishing and ensuring species remain viable for future generations.
